All Categories
Featured
Table of Contents
To put it simply, employers looking for technical candidates intend to learn what a prospect can do prior to they learn who they are. One of the most crucial characteristics candidates have to show is verifiable coding ability. Organizations employing for technical functions want to see that you can believe via a trouble, craft a reaction and review/test your code.
The technological market is one-of-a-kind because effective interviewing calls for having specific, customized knowledge (data science interview preparation). Organizations commonly evaluate this understanding at the initial stage of the interview process, conserving concerns about your passions, character and experience for future rounds. A technological analysis generally takes one of 2 forms: a timed, self-directed examination or an online coding session with a job interviewer
In one or more succeeding interviews, the recruiter(s) will certainly ask concerns that better analyze exactly how your individuality and rate of interests align with the organization. Reduce and assume via the inquiry first, as there may be several steps to comply with or certain details to make up. Develop in a process for checking your code.
There's most likely something you do not know or info in an interview prompt might be missing or misleading. Show your recruiter that you are astute and curious by asking inquiries.
, a site featuring comprehensive information on what it's actually like to work within a market, business or profession.
We'll begin by covering what a technological interview involves. We'll get right into what you can anticipate throughout a technical meeting in each phase of the procedure and what you can do to stand out.
And we'll finish up with suggestions on getting ready for a technological interview (plus what not to do). Inside, you'll likewise discover coding interview suggestions and advice from technological interview specialists that have actually undergone the process themselves AND carried out technology meetings from the other end of the table. Their first-hand understanding will certainly show you just how to prepare for a technological interview with real-world considerations in mind.
If you've been invited for a virtual tech meeting, discover regarding the remote meeting procedure, plus some virtual technological interview tips for success. Unlike various other types of work meetings, tech work meetings entail obstacles and tasks. They're extra like an exam than a normal question-and-answer interview. Like the phrase "Show, do not tell," you need to confirm that you have the technology skills called for to do the work, instead of just inform the job interviewer that you have them.
An initial technical testing meeting usually lasts 15-30 mins. Some firms will desire to check your coding abilities with an initial test before having you in fact are available in. It might be performed over the phone, via Skype or Zoom, or as a homework-type project via an internet application or e-mail.
This is the stage that many people call the actual "technological meeting." It entails an in-person interview with coding obstacles you have to finish on a white boards before the interviewer(s). Tech meetings at this stage can likewise be done from another location over video clip meeting if the company is remote.
As I claimed before, however, every company's tech meeting process is different. Here are a few instances of how some prominent tech firms arrange their technical interview stages:: initial phone or Google Hangout interview (30-60 minutes); onsite technology interview (4 hours comprised of 4 separate interviews): Initial technical testing meeting (30-50 min); onsite interview (1 complete day): first phone display (30-60 min); in-person meeting (1 complete day made up of 6 back-to-back personal and technological meetings) Just how to plan for a software designer interview likewise relies on the standing of the role you're using fore.g.
To find more regarding what the business you're interviewing with could ask you, or even more about their technical meeting process, do a little research. Inspect to see if the business has a technology blog site. In some cases companies commit whole blog short articles to their tech interview process and what to expect (here's an instance from a firm called Asana).
Right here is Google's interview tab on Glassdoor. This responses can be concerning conventional or technical interviews, and some users could even share what sort of coding interview inquiries they were asked. If you're still losing, shoot the employer or employing manager a quick email asking what the meeting process will appear like.
Naturally, this is one more variable that will certainly vary from company to business, yet you'll generally be taking a look at either scenarios based upon company dimension:: participant(s) of the design team, an elderly developer, or perhaps the CTO. All job interviewers commonly have technical experience and might be your future bosses or colleagues.
It can alleviate your interview anxiousness to place a face to a name, plus you could discover something you can link over (you mosted likely to the same college, you have similar interests, or something like that to start the ball rolling). For more on using LinkedIn to get a first step, look into this overview to obtaining task recommendations even as a technology novice.
Other companies may focus more on real-world issues that look like everyday job at the business. Let's look briefly at some of the types and subjects of developer interview concerns you may encounter throughout a technical meeting.
These inquiries pertain to how you've acted in a certain circumstance in the past. These are based on genuine life situations you've encountered. Examples include: Tell me about a time when you managed a difficult situation. Give me an example of a time when you functioned successfully under pressure. What took place when you slipped up at the workplace? These interview inquiries handle theoretical scenarios in the future and what you could do in that certain scenario.
Technical meeting questions that analyze your actual abilities and knowledge is the heart of the tech interview. These can be tech-oriented trivia-type inquiries like: Exactly how can you make certain that your code is both safe and rapid? When do you utilize polymorphism? Explain the difference between an array and a linked checklist.
That's since what most companies need to know, much more so than what truths you've memorized, is just how well you can fix problems. As we have actually noted, there are not actually any type of "usual" technological interview concerns when it comes to specifics. However, there are a couple of common styles and topics of coding interview concerns that frequently show up in technical interviews across different markets: Information frameworks Algorithms Databases System layout Networking Problem-solving For a lot more on this, have a look at my guide to usual technical meeting questions.
Table of Contents
Latest Posts
Which Service Offers The Best Support For Tech Career Prep?
What Should I Expect From A High-Level Machine Learning Bootcamp?
Who Offers The Best System Design Mastery?
More
Latest Posts
Which Service Offers The Best Support For Tech Career Prep?
What Should I Expect From A High-Level Machine Learning Bootcamp?
Who Offers The Best System Design Mastery?